Summary

An inscribed medieval seal was found in 1754 at an unknown location in the parish.

1754. At unknown site.
Seal, oval; S CAPITVLI SCI SEPULCRI DE CADOMO.
(S1) claims this refers to the cell of St Stephen of Caen at Gayton.
